Hi
I've just upgraded from 7.4.3 to 7.5.4 via the package manager console on a local build
It seems to have run ok, there is nothing in the umbracolog table to suggest otherwise.
I also still have a perfectly good installedPackages.config containing packages I have installed.
However the installed packages folder does not appear in the developer tab any more.
I tried installing another package, imageGen, which installed successfully, but still, no installed packages folder.
I've also tried clearing my cache, but to no avail. Anyone else seen this?

Ignore me
They've just changed the UX You get to installed packages now via the installed tab off of the main tree node.
